Comprehending Dumpster Rental: Whatever You Need to Know

Dumpster rental is an exceptional service for handling big amounts of waste generated by various tasks such as home renovations, building and construction, or major cleanouts. However, comprehending how dumpster rental works can assist guarantee you get the right service and value for your needs. Here's a thorough guide to understanding dumpster rental.

Dumpster rentals are practical for:

Home Renovations: Whether you're renovating your cooking area, restroom, or whole home, you'll generate a lot of waste.
Building Projects: New buildings, demolitions, and landscaping jobs produce significant particles.
Major Cleanouts: Spring cleaning, estate cleanouts, or decluttering efforts require efficient waste disposal.
Event Cleanups: Large events can produce considerable amounts of trash that need to be managed quickly.

Choosing the Right Dumpster

Dumpsters come in various sizes, designed to accommodate different types and volumes of waste. When choosing a dumpster, think about the scope of your task and the quantity of particles it will produce. Rental companies generally provide dumpsters suitable for small cleanouts, medium-sized renovations, and large-scale building and construction tasks.

Comprehending Costs - The expense of renting a dumpster can vary based upon numerous aspects:

Size: Larger dumpsters cost more than smaller sized ones.
Rental Period: The length of time you need the dumpster will affect the rate.
Area: Rental rates can vary by region.
Kind of Waste: Some products may incur extra costs, particularly hazardous waste.

To get the very best offer, compare quotes from different rental companies and ask about any possible concealed fees.

Rental Period and Flexibility: Most business provide flexible rental durations, usually ranging from a couple of days to a week or more. It's important to estimate how long you'll require the dumpster to avoid additional charges for extended usage. If your job takes longer than expected, examine if the rental company uses easy extensions.

Permits and Regulations: In some locations, you might require an authorization to put a dumpster on public property, like a street or pathway. Always examine local guidelines and secure any essential licenses before your dumpster arrives. Rental business can often help assist you through this process.

Ecological Considerations: Responsible waste disposal is vital for environmental protection. Try to find rental companies that focus on environmentally friendly practices, such as recycling and proper disposal of dangerous materials. This ensures that your waste is managed in an ecologically responsible way.

Filling the Dumpster - To take full advantage of area and avoid extra costs, follow these loading ideas:

Even Distribution: Spread the waste equally to avoid overwhelming one side.
Break Down Items: Break down big items to fit more into the dumpster.
Avoid Prohibited Items: Do not deal with harmful materials, electronics, or tires unless allowed by the rental business.
Fill Level: Do not overfill the dumpster. Keep waste listed below the top edge to guarantee safe transport.
